The coronavirus pandemic was kind to Andrew Cuomo. The New York governor has a well-earned reputation as something of a bare-fisted political thug in Albany but an event that turned out to be a disaster for President Donald Trump and most Americans has been a political windfall for Cuomo.
Or at least it was until last week, when New York Attorney General Letitia James issued a report concluding Cuomo’s administration had undercounted the number of coronavirus deaths of nursing home patients by nearly 4,000. The real death total was far higher than Cuomo had claimed. Within hours of the report being issued, the state Health Department released previously unpublished records acknowledging that the real number was 12,743, not 8,740 as posted by the state’s website only hours earlier.
All of this illustrates the cost of an avoidable error: a March 25, 2020, New York state order handed down by Cuomo and his health department ordered nursing homes to accept recovering coronavirus patients despite the risk to other residents.
